Korean antique pottery jar/17th-19th century/Beautiful glazed /Joseon Dynasty
About the Item
We would like to introduce beautiful old Korean pottery.
This is excavated pottery made during the Joseon Dynasty (17th-19th century).
During the Joseon Dynasty, common people were prohibited from using white porcelain pottery, and instead used other glazes for everyday pottery.
This item is also a pottery that was used as an everyday item by the common people, and is a simple yet beautiful pot.
The glaze is straw ash glaze, and the glaze is thick and pale, which is a characteristic of straw ash glaze.
In Japan, this type of pottery is called ``Kainei.''
It has been brought to Japan since ancient times and has been loved.
Although this pottery is an excavated item, it is in good condition, and there are some repair marks on a part of the mouth (marked in red), but other than that there are no noticeable scratches.
It didn't leak even when I added water.
This seems to have been used as a tea utensil in Japan.
The purpose of use is to fill it with clean water and add water to the tea kettle, or to wash (purify) tea bowls, etc.
This vase also comes with a foul painted lid.
A wooden box for storage is also included.
This type of vase is a somewhat rare design among ancient Korean ceramics.
